Russia Claims Warning Shots Were Fired at Royal Navy Warship in The Black Sea

The Ministry of Defence has denied a report by the Russian defence ministry that warning shots and bombs were dropped nearby HMS Defender in the Black Sea

Daily Mirror UK, 24 JUN 2021












HMS Defender arrived for a port visit in Istanbul, Turkey on June 9, 2021 (Image: Shaun Roster / SWNS)


Russia claims it fired warning shots at a Royal Navy destroyer HMS Defender in the Black Sea - but the UK's Ministry of Defence has denied any shots were fired.

According to the Russians the HMS Defender had entered Russian waters and a Russian jet dropped bombs in its path.

But a statement from the British Ministry of Defence reads: "No warning shots have been fired at HMS Defender.

"The Royal Navy ship is conducting innocent passage through Ukrainian territorial waters in accordance with international law.

"We believe the Russians were undertaking a gunnery exercise in the Black Sea and provided the maritime community with prior-warning of their activity.

"No shots were directed at HMS Defender and we do not recognise the claim that bombs were dropped in her path."

The Russians claim the HMS Defender left Russian waters soon afterwards, "having ventured as much as 3 kilometres (2 miles) inside".

The dispute is likely to revolve around the territorial waters of Crimea which was annexed from Ukraine by Russia, a move that saw Russia expelled from the then-G8.

The UK has never acknowledged Russian sovereignty of the region.

A statement from the Russian Ministry of Defence read: "At 11:52am on 23 June, the HMS Defender of the British Royal Navy, operating in the northwestern part of the Black Sea, violated the border and entered three kilometres into Russian territorial waters in the region of Cape Fiolent.

"At 12:06 and 12:08, a border patrol vessel carried out warning shots.

"At 12:19 a Su-24M carried out a warning bombing run using 4 OFAB-250 [high-explosive fragmentation] bombs at the HMS Defender's path of movement.

"At 12:23 the combined actions of the Black Sea Fleet and the Border Forces of the FSB forced the HMS Defender to leave the territorial waters of the Russian Federation."

The destroyer had been on operations in the Black Sea with American navy guided missile destroyer USS Laboon and Dutch warship HNLMS Evertsen in a show of support for Ukraine following Putin’s recent vast military build up close to Ukrainian borders.

Russia has said in recent days that it was closely monitoring HMS Defender, which is capable of carrying up to 56 Tomahawk cruise missiles at any one time.

Defence Secretary Ben Wallace said that HMS Defender had been "shadowed" by Russian ships and had been "made aware" of training exercises in the area.

"This morning, HMS Defender carried out a routine transit from Odessa towards Georgia across the Black Sea," he said.

"As is normal for this route, she entered an internationally-recognised traffic separation corridor. She exited that corridor safely at 0945 BST.

"As is routine, Russian vessels shadowed her passage and she was made aware of training exercises in her wider vicinity."

The Russian Defence Ministry reportedly said the ship had violated Russia's border, according to Russian news agency Interfax.

An earlier image taken from Royal Navy destroyer HMS Defender showed Russian frigate Admiral Essen "shadowing" USS Laboon.

Russia’s national defence control centre said: "Forces and systems of the [Russian] Black Sea Fleet have started monitoring the movements of the Royal Navy HMS Defender and the Dutch Navy's Evertsen frigate.”

The fleet’s former commander Admiral Vladimir Komoyedov said: ”Those ships will definitely not be welcome here.

“No-one is going to greet them as guests of honour, while their actions will definitely be monitored.

“They will be put under direct surveillance, technically, from the air and from outer space.”

The admiral added: "Their visits to the Black Sea have become too frequent.

“Their intensified presence has gone too far.

“They are complying with the Montreux Convention, but the activity of ships from non-Black Sea countries has never been so intensive before, even in the Soviet period.”

The latest flare-up comes amid months of tensions between Moscow and the west following a build-up earlier this year of Russian forces on the border with Ukraine.
